Mehat

Mehat is a village in Phagwara tehsil in Kapurthala district of Punjab State, India. It is located 35 kilometres (22 mi) from Kapurthala, 5 kilometres (3.1 mi) from Phagwara. The village is administrated by a Sarpanch who is an elected representative of village as per the constitution of India and Panchayati raj (India).
